2. Important Safety Information

Please read all safety instructions carefully before installation and operation. Failure to follow these instructions could result in electric shock, fire, property damage, or serious injury.

  • Electrical Installation: This unit operates on 240 Volts, 75A, 60 HZ. Do not connect the plug directly. Installation must be performed by a qualified and licensed electrician in accordance with all local and national electrical codes.
  • Water Connections: Ensure all water connections are secure and leak-free before operating the heater. A water pump is required for proper circulation.
  • Grounding: The heater must be properly grounded to prevent electrical shock.
  • Location: Install the heater in a location that is protected from direct weather exposure and allows for adequate ventilation.
  • Children: Keep children away from the heater and its controls.
  • Maintenance: Disconnect power to the unit before performing any maintenance or service.

3.2 Water Connection

The heater requires a continuous flow of water from your pool's filtration system. Connect the heater in-line after the filter and before any chemical feeders. The unit features standard inlet/outlet ports.

  • Ensure the water pump is operational and provides adequate flow through the heater.
  • The outlet port measures approximately 38mm to 42mm in diameter. Use appropriate plumbing fittings to ensure a watertight seal.

3.3 Electrical Connection

This heater is designed for 240V, 75A, 60 HZ American voltage systems. It must be hardwired by a professional electrician. Do not attempt to connect this unit to a standard wall outlet.

  • Ensure the main power supply to the circuit is turned off before beginning any electrical work.
  • Connect the heater to a dedicated circuit breaker of appropriate amperage (75A recommended).
  • Follow all wiring diagrams provided by your electrician and adhere to local electrical codes.

4. Operating Instructions

Once properly installed and all connections are verified, you can begin operating your AYCHLG pool water heater.

4.1 Initial Startup

  1. Ensure the pool pump is running and water is circulating through the heater. The heater requires adequate water flow to operate safely.
  2. Turn on the power supply to the heater at the circuit breaker.
  3. Locate the power switch on the heater's control panel and turn it to the 'ON' position.
  4. The digital display will illuminate, showing the current water temperature.

4.2 Setting Temperature

Use the control buttons on the front panel to adjust the desired water temperature. Refer to the heater's display for current and set temperatures.

4.3 Heating Performance

The 18KW heater provides a heating capacity of 60,000 Btu/Hr. It is suitable for pools up to approximately 7500 gallons in coastal climates. Actual heating time will vary based on pool size, ambient temperature, desired temperature, and insulation.

5. Maintenance

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and efficient operation of your pool water heater.

  • Routine Checks: Periodically inspect the heater for any signs of leaks, corrosion, or damage to electrical components.
  • Water Chemistry: Maintain proper pool water chemistry (pH, alkalinity, calcium hardness) to prevent scale buildup and corrosion within the heater's elements.
  • Flow Rate: Ensure consistent and adequate water flow through the heater. Reduced flow can lead to overheating and damage.
  • Winterization: In colder climates, the heater must be properly drained and winterized to prevent freezing damage. Consult a pool professional for proper winterization procedures.
  • Cleaning: Keep the exterior of the heater clean and free from debris.

6. Troubleshooting

This section addresses common issues you might encounter with your pool water heater. For problems not listed here, please contact customer support.

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Heater not turning onNo power, tripped breaker, faulty wiring.Check circuit breaker. Ensure unit is properly wired by a professional.
Water not heatingInsufficient water flow, incorrect temperature setting, heating element failure.Verify pump is running and filter is clean. Adjust temperature setting. Contact support if element is suspected.
Low water flow errorClogged filter, pump issue, closed valve.Clean or backwash filter. Check pump operation. Ensure all valves are open.
LeakageLoose connections, damaged seals, cracked housing.Tighten all plumbing connections. Inspect seals and housing for damage. Contact support if damage is found.
